Tim Foote, from Belle Property Mosman, is selling perhaps one of the only actual castles on the market in Australia at the moment, in Sydney’s desirable Castle Cove.

He said the imposing property is a “magnificent example of perpendicular Gothic architecture.”

“It is incredible. It has been owned by the same entity since 1988. It showcases a lavish sandstone build and takes the name ‘Innisfallen Castle’, or ‘Island of the Field’, from an Irish castle in Killarney [and it gazes] out over the soothing blue waters of Fig Tree Cove,” Mr Foote said.

The price guide for the property is a predicable king’s ransom at more than $32 million.

“I think [the buyer] is probably going to be an Aussie expat returning home who wants to be close to the city and have a property that is quite simply, like no other,” he said.

The eight-bedroom castle in Castle Cove has echoes of High Garden, the home of the Tyrells in the series.

The heritage-listed building built in 1904, which sits on 8333sqm of lush grounds, inspired the name of the suburb back in the day and would be an ideal place to bunker down. The listing also includes separate accommodation perfect for guests or domestic staff.

Set in Guanaba, in the gorgeous Gold Coast hinterland, this luxurious property has a sprawling 55-acre estate worth fighting a battle for and a home theatre with episode marathon written all over it.

On the market for $21.5 million, Rivermead Estate features a spectacular six-bedroom plantation-style homestead, a three-bedroom pool and guesthouse, perfectly manicured lawns, a lake, grazing fields and even a macadamia tree plantation.
